I have and use both programs. When Easy AC has determined the correct offset for my drive (so AccurateRip can verify), it is fast, easy, and works well -- except that it often fails to find cover art for classical CDs that Exact AC *does* find cover art for.
Both programs are supposed to use GD3 for metadata, yes? (I paid for the GD3 license for Exact AC to use.) Why, then, does Exact AC find more art than Easy AC?

Yes, both use GD3 for cover art search (if selected in Exact Audio Copy as metadata provider). So basically Easy Audio Copy should find at least covers for the same CDs as found in Exact Audio Copy. But if you have a specific CD which can be found in Exact Audio Copy but not in Easy Audio Copy, please send me an email so that I can try to find the problem...
